how Forest River responds when repairs needed, etc.

They don't. Even when brand new & under warranty, you get repairs through a dealer, not Forest River itself. They are strictly a factory, selling wholesale. Since you are looking at a 2016, it is almost surely used and you would be a second owner.  No warranty, unless the seller makes some sort of promise for future repairs, but most are sold "as is".  Forest River sells parts only through their dealer network, never direct to owners, and generally doesn't have much in the way of parts anyway.  RVs are built almost exclusively using components supplied by 3rd party suppliers, everything from trailer frame & axles to water heaters and fridges. Parts for those,  or replacements for them, are often readily available from RV stores online or locally. About the only thing that FR supplies is the roof, sidewalls, and cabinetry. And unlike cars, there is no assurance that parts will be available for any period of time.
